seeker1 Dec 30, 2023 @ 5:42am 
Question 1. Are you using a mod manager? You should. Mods can work and then cause crashes and problems after a patch. They can conflict with each other. A mod manager helps you disable them, so you can find the source of the problem. It also sometimes matters the load order, which a manager can help you change.

Iron Reaper Dec 30, 2023 @ 6:52am 
Only use mods that have no bugs, you can find out by looking at the bug reports or checking the comments section on nexus. Bg3 is still releasing patches which breaks mods so there are a lot of moving parts right now, meaning the safest way is to not use any at all or be very careful what you use. To fix your broken game, do a full uninstall, then delete the game folder and any remaining files, then reinstall a fresh copy and start a new game from scratch

Iron Reaper Dec 30, 2023 @ 10:21am 
Originally posted by hanji:
Originally posted by Meat Cannon:

If you delete mods in the middle of your playthrough it can cause a lot of problems depending on the mod

At this point with that dll issue I would just start fresh bro

do you happen to know if restauring the mods i deleted can have some effect? but ty im not that long in the game yet so starting fresh luckily wont be a burden lolzz

I guess it depends on the mod but if it is a mod type that is prone to issues it usually some parts of it get baked into your save and just cease to function properly, so it just crashes when it can’t compete whatever it was doing

Sometimes you can get around it by selling or destroying anything in game from that mod before you remove the mod, but not always. Again it depends what it is.. things with scripts are going to be problematic but aesthetics like a new face model for your character would probably be fine as long as you swapped to another face before you removed the mod

When you install a mod mid-playthrough that you haven’t used before, back up your save first and then test it right away and check the mod’s bug page and comments for users having problems.
